A WHOIS lookup is a search query that pulls up the latest registration details of a domain name or IP address. It queries the WHOIS database and returns information like who registered the domain, when, and which company manages it.
Originally, these lookups relied on the WHOIS protocol, however, lately, many lookups run on a newer protocol called Registration Data Access Protocol (RDAP) instead of the classic WHOIS, since ICANN now requires all gTLDs to support RDAP. The result is similar — a report on who registered a particular domain or IP. Since the process of obtaining domain registration information has been historically known as a WHOIS lookup, the industry continues to refer to it that way, even though, in many cases, it is in fact an RDAP lookup.
The exact fields you get depend on the lookup protocol, the registry, and registrar.
A typical WHOIS record includes the domain's registrar, its creation and expiration dates, the nameservers it uses, and the registrant's contact details, if they're not hidden. For IP addresses, you'll usually see the network range, the organization it's assigned to, and contact info for that network. The exact fields can vary a bit depending on the registry or registrar.

Privacy laws such as GDPR prompted ICANN to adopt policy — originally the 2018 Temporary Specification, now ICANN's permanent Registration Data Policy (in full effect since August 21, 2025) — requiring registrars to redact registrant names, email addresses, and phone numbers by default. Some registrars offer domain privacy protection services that replace the registrant’s real contact information with a proxy address.

WHOIS and RDAP are both protocols used to look up domain registration data.
WHOIS is an older protocol that returns plain text, and its format can vary from one registrar to the next.
RDAP is the newer standard that ICANN now requires for gTLDs. It returns structured JSON data instead of freeform text, which makes it easier for software to parse consistently.
RDAP also supports differentiated access, meaning some data can be shown to certain requestors and hidden from others, a feature WHOIS never had. You can read more in our full breakdown of WHOIS vs. RDAP.

A WHOIS lookup tells you who owns a domain and how to reach the registrar. A DNS lookup tells you how that domain is configured to work online, showing records like the IP address it points to or its mail servers.
There's some overlap, though. Nameservers appear in both a WHOIS record and a DNS lookup, since they're part of the domain's registration data and control how its DNS is resolved.
Yes. An IP WHOIS lookup returns the organization the IP address is registered to, along with contact details, usually maintained by a regional internet registry like ARIN or RIPE rather than a domain registrar.

It can, but the reason usually comes down to the data itself, not the lookup tool. WHOIS records depend on what the registrant entered when they signed up, so if someone moved or changed their phone number and never updated their registrar, the record goes stale. So a WHOIS lookup is only as accurate as the information behind it.
ICANN requires registrars to investigate and correct inaccurate data, and you can file a complaint with ICANN if you spot something wrong.
